Understanding Plug Types in India

From my experience, the most common plug types I’ve seen in India are Type C, Type D, and Type M. Some places may also accept Type A or Type B in certain cases, but I never rely on that. I always check the plug shape on my device and compare it with the sockets I expect to find in India.

Checking Voltage Compatibility

One thing I always verify is voltage. India generally uses 230V with a frequency of 50Hz. My devices must support that range, or I need a voltage converter. I’ve found that many modern chargers for phones, tablets, and laptops are dual voltage, but I still read the label carefully before packing.

Adapter vs. Converter: What I Use

I make sure I understand the difference between an adapter and a converter. An adapter only changes the plug shape, while a converter changes the voltage. For my phone and laptop chargers, I usually only need an adapter because they already support 100V–240V. For appliances like hair dryers or straighteners, I often need a converter, and sometimes I avoid bringing them altogether.

My Safety Tips for Using Adapters in India

I always use adapters from trusted brands because safety matters to me. I never overload a single adapter with too many high-power devices. I also avoid using damaged cords or loose sockets. If I notice heat, sparks, or unusual smells, I stop using the adapter immediately.
